Discovering Ljubljana
The city tour lasts around 2.5 hours, giving you a solid overview of Ljubljana’s most iconic sights. Expect to see the plethora of architectural styles, from Baroque to modern, and learn about the city’s vibrant culture. Reviews mention guides like Micho and Clement as being particularly friendly and knowledgeable, making the city’s history and quirks more accessible. One traveler from Hong Kong highlighted how Clement’s humor made the city tour more enjoyable, blending facts with fun.
After the guided part, you’ll have about 1.5 hours of free time for shopping, wandering, or enjoying a coffee break. That’s enough to grab a local snack or browse the charming shops, especially if you’re keen to soak in more of Ljubljana’s lively atmosphere.
Scenic Drive to Lake Bled
Next, the bus takes you on a roughly 1-hour scenic drive to Lake Bled, renowned for its picture-perfect setting. The journey itself is comfortable, with air conditioning and a small group size that keeps things intimate.
Lake Bled: A Fairytale Scene
Upon arrival, you’re treated to a photo stop of the lake’s pristine waters and surrounding hills. The highlight? Riding a traditional “pletna” boat to Bled Island. This is a classic activity, and although it costs extra (€20), reviewers say it’s worthwhile for the experience and views. The boat cruise is around 75 minutes, during which you can take photos, explore the island, and enjoy the calm serenity of the lake.
You’ll also have the chance to explore Bled Castle, perched above the lake on a cliff. The guided tour here lasts about an hour, giving plenty of opportunity to walk around, take in the panoramic vistas, and learn about the castle’s history. Many reviews mention how stunning the views from the castle are—ideal for memorable photos.
More Great Thing To Do NearbyAdditional Experiences and Flexibility
While the boat ride (€20) and castle entrance (€18) are not included in the base price, reviewers feel these are good value for the experience. Some mention that the castle visit includes tasting local Cream Cake, a Bled specialty, which adds a sweet touch to the day.
The tour wraps up with a scenic drive back to Zagreb, lasting around 2.5 hours, giving you time to relax or reflect on the day’s highlights.

Practical Tips for Travelers

- Wear comfortable walking shoes—both Ljubljana and Bled involve some strolling.
- Bring your passport (or EU ID card), especially if you plan to visit Bled Castle or ride the boat.
- Consider reserving the optional boat ride (€20) and castle entrance (€18) in advance if possible, to secure your spot.
- Pack a camera or smartphone to capture the stunning views from Bled Castle and the boat.
- Bring some cash or cards for optional extras like the boat or castle entry fees.
- The entire trip is quite packed, so be prepared for a full day with some early starts and limited free time outside scheduled stops.

FAQ

How long is the drive from Zagreb to Ljubljana?
It takes about 1 hour by van, making the travel comfortable and quick enough to maximize your sightseeing time.
What are the pickup options?
There are 14 pickup locations in Zagreb, including several hotels and the parking garage at Hotel Sheraton, providing flexibility to travelers.
Is the tour suitable for those with mobility issues?
No, it’s not recommended for people with mobility impairments or wheelchair users due to walking involved at the stops.
What’s included in the price?
Transportation in an air-conditioned vehicle, a driver/guide, and guided sightseeing tours of Ljubljana and Lake Bled are included.
Are meals provided?
No, food and drinks are not included, so you might want to bring snacks or plan to purchase food during free time.
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ering some flexibility in case plans change.
What should I bring?
Your passport or EU ID, comfortable clothes and shoes, and optional cash for extras like the boat or castle entry.
How long do we stay at each location?
You’ll have about 2.5 hours in Ljubljana (including guided tour and free time), 3.5 hours at Bled (photo stop, free time, castle visit, boat ride).
Is it worth adding the boat ride and castle entry?
Many reviewers say yes, as these are the highlights of Lake Bled, offering unforgettable views and experiences that complement the tour.
